Output 81ca4e782ae99d93c1c17d49f974bada1d3247fd0e7de1a72cbb6a5e20b831d2:0

value
1409302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75de15608412713c38b7aeb493bc48a0e479de6a OP_EQUAL
address
3CSF2cvtpjiuvmAMywHbmqi6HTTsMmzdXD
transaction
81ca4e782ae99d93c1c17d49f974bada1d3247fd0e7de1a72cbb6a5e20b831d2
spent
true